Using Data Analytics to Improve Recruitment Outcomes
In today's competitive job market, leveraging data analytics has become essential for enhancing recruitment outcomes. Organizations that utilize data-driven approaches can streamline their hiring processes, reduce time-to-fill, and improve the quality of hires. According to a report by LinkedIn, companies that use data analytics in recruitment are 3 times more likely to make better hiring decisions (LinkedIn Talent Solutions, 2020).
One effective example of data analytics in recruitment is the case of Unilever. The multinational consumer goods company employed machine learning algorithms to assess candidates through video interviews. This innovative approach allowed them to reduce their interview process by 50% while simultaneously improving the quality of their hires (Harvard Business Review, 2019). By analyzing various candidate attributes and performance metrics, Unilever was able to identify the best-fit candidates more efficiently.

Another noteworthy example is IBM's use of predictive analytics in their recruitment process. By analyzing historical hiring data and employee performance, IBM developed algorithms that predict which candidates are likely to succeed in specific roles. This approach has led to a significant increase in employee retention and satisfaction (IBM Smarter Workforce Institute, 2018).
